Federal Class Action Lawsuit Against Opera Event, Community First Games, and Individual Founders on Behalf of Communi3 and Rifters NFT Purchasers Filed Burwick Law has filed a class action lawsuit on behalf of Plaintiff Alex Orea in the United States District Court for the Southern District of New York against Opera Event, Inc., Community First Games, Brandon Byrne, Andrew Ringlein, Erik Bryant, Eddie Tsaio, and Matt Espinoza. The complaint alleges violations of California's Unfair Competition Law, California's False Advertising Law, and unjust enrichment. The lawsuit seeks restitution, disgorgement, and injunctive relief on behalf of a nationwide class. According to the complaint, Defendants marketed Communi3 as a thriving enterprise software platform serving blue-chip clients including The Sandbox, Yield Guild Games, and Magic Eden, while selling a series of non-fungible token collections on the Solana blockchain tied to promises of a forthcoming cryptocurrency token called $SCI. The complaint alleges that Defendants told Mad Scientist NFT holders that ten percent of the $SCI token supply would be airdropped to them and projected a fully diluted market capitalization of $250 million to $500 million, with per-token prices of $0.25 to $0.50. The complaint further alleges that Defendants promised the $SCI token launch for Q3 2022, then December 2022, then Q1 2023, and that each successive promise served to keep investors from selling while Defendants continued collecting proceeds. The $SCI token was never launched and no airdrop was ever distributed. The Communi3 platform launched in approximately 2021 as a pivot from Opera Event's original esports-focused software business. Defendants launched multiple NFT collections on the Solana blockchain between April 2022 and late 2023: Communi3: Laboratories (100 NFTs at approximately $100,000 each), Communi3: Mad Scientists (5,001 NFTs at 2 SOL each), Adorable Assistants, and Rifters: Exiles (7,037 NFTs at 10 SOL each). The complaint alleges that Defendants raised conservatively $6.5 million to $8 million or more in direct NFT mint proceeds. The complaint further alleges that Defendants promoted the project at NFT NYC 2022 in New York City, hosting an exclusive investor event and using the industry's flagship conference to reinforce the same representations they were disseminating through Discord, Twitter, and Medium. According to the complaint, in a June 2023 Discord exchange, Defendant Ringlein stated in substance that any investors who sued would be unable to recover against him because the Rifters entity had been organized in Panama and he was effectively judgment-proof. By early 2023, platform activity had ceased, the $SCI token had not launched, and the digital assets became effectively worthless. The Court has authorized us to serve lawsuits on defendants in an alleged $440M ponzi scheme to their ETH wallets, along with email, social media DMs, and other digital means. The case will now move forward after a year-long delay caused by these foreign defendants' efforts to conceal their identities. (Adams v. Gharib, No. 24-cv-09378 (S.D.N.Y.))
